We each hereby expressly release the other from all claims and demands, known and unknown, arising out of the Agreement. Each party understands that, as to claims that are known to that party when the release is signed, any statutory provisions that would otherwise apply to limit this general release are hereby waived.

The Parties hereby release each other from all actions, causes of action, liabilities, or claims. The parties hereby agree not to sue each other for any matter related to any matter that arose prior to the date this agreement is signed and agree not to seek damages from each other.

Any party involved in the dispute will have to sign the agreement for mutual release. Mutual release agreements are used in various areas of the law in many types of disputes. Before signing any type of release agreement, both parties must know what their rights are and what they are agreeing to give up by signing.

The preamble of a mutual release typically gives a brief summary of the subject claim or controversy. The operative clauses then go on to specify that the parties mutually "release" each other from any and all claims, counterclaims, cross-claims, third-party claims, and/or causes of action.
